DbServer.RecordInfo 方法 | |
检索有关指定记录的信息。
命名空间:
XSharp.VO.SDK
程序集:
XSharp.VORDDClasses (在 XSharp.VORDDClasses.dll 中) 版本:2.22 GA
语法 VIRTUAL METHOD RecordInfo(
kRecInfoType AS LONG,
nRecordNumber AS LONG,
uRecVal AS USUAL
) AS USUAL
public virtual __Usual RecordInfo(
int kRecInfoType,
[DefaultParameterValueAttribute(0, 0)] int nRecordNumber,
[DefaultParameterValueAttribute(0, 1)] __Usual uRecVal
)
查看代码参数
- kRecInfoType
- 类型:Int32
检索的信息取决于指定的常量
- nRecordNumber
- 类型:Int32
指示要检索信息的记录;如果为 0 或省略,则指当前记录。 - uRecVal
- 类型:__Usual
此参数保留用于允许更改信息而不仅仅是检索信息的 RDD。提供的 RDD(如《程序员指南》附录中的“RDD
细节”中所述)不支持此参数。要么省略参数,要么将其指定为 NIL。
返回值
类型:
__Usual
返回值的数据类型取决于请求的值。
备注 Constant | 返回值 |
---|
DBRI_BUFFPTR
| 指向当前记录缓冲区的指针 |
DBRI_DELETED
| 记录是否已删除? |
DBRI_DELETED | 记录是否已删除? |
DBRI_RECSIZE
|
记录长度。
|
DBRI_LOCKED |
记录是否已锁定?
|
DBRI_RECNO | 记录位置(类似于 RecNo 访问)。 |
提示: |
---|
DBRI_USER 是一个常量,返回第三方 RDD 开发人员可以用于自定义的最小值。
小于 DBRI_USER 的值保留给 X# 开发。
|
参见